Hello,
I'm using glpk-java. I need to model a max() function similar to Excel.
max(3, 5, 7, 1) = 7
e.g.:
a,b,c,d,e,f,g,h and i are binary variables
m is an integer variable [0..+infinity[
m <= max(a, b + c + d, e + f, g+ h + i)
Any suggestion?
